Plant Hormone
Chemical substances produced in plants that regulate growth, development, and other physiological processes.
2,4-D
An herbicide used to control broadleaf weeds, functioning as a synthetic auxin to disrupt plant growth.
2,4,5-T
A synthetic herbicide used for broad-leaf plant control that was a component of Agent Orange, now banned in many countries due to its toxicity and carcinogenic properties.
Thigmomorphogenesis
The process by which plants change their growth patterns in response to mechanical stimulation, such as touch or wind.
